Submit form in frame + event Handlers = new Window ... Why?
От: Andir Россия
Дата: 17.02.03 08:45
Оценка:
Привет RSDN!

Теперь мне нужна помощь ...

Ситуация такая:
Страница состоит из двух фреймов:
frame1 и frame2 (Причом второй фрейм имеет имя name="frame2")
Далее, в первом фрейме есть некая форма которая сабмитится во второй фрейм (target="frame2").
Во втором есть некоторый event handler события "onload", который подключается следующим образом : window.attachEvent("onload", OnloadHandler).
Теперь пытаюсь сабмитить форму, первый раз всё нормально, во второй раз стабильно открывается новое окно ...
Убираю из второго фрейма event handler и всё как и задумывалось (форма сабмитится во второй фрейм постоянно).

Как бы избавится от такого эффекта ???

P.S. От типа события тоже ничего не зависит, главное чтобы оно сработало хотя бы раз. (проверял на "document.onclick").

С Уважением, Andir!
... << using( RSDN@Home 1.0 beta 5 ) {/* Работаем */} >>
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.